About Bing Su

Bing Su is a scholar working on Molecular Biology, Immunology, Oncology, Cancer Research and Genetics, having authored 179 papers that have together received 18.0k indexed citations. Recurring topics across this work include PI3K/AKT/mTOR signaling in cancer (28 papers), Melanoma and MAPK Pathways (25 papers), T-cell and B-cell Immunology (22 papers), Cytokine Signaling Pathways and Interactions (21 papers), Immune Cell Function and Interaction (20 papers), NF-κB Signaling Pathways (15 papers), Protein Kinase Regulation and GTPase Signaling (13 papers) and interferon and immune responses (11 papers). The work is most often cited by research in Immunology (5.4k citations), Cancer Research (2.9k citations), Molecular Biology (10.5k citations), Oncology (2.5k citations) and Aging (152 citations). Bing Su has collaborated with scholars based in United States, China and Thailand. Frequent co-authors include Michael Karin, Masahiko Hibi, Roger J. Davis, Estela Jacinto, Tamera Barrett, I‐Huan Wu, Tiliang Deng, Benoit Dérijard, Valeria Facchinetti and Tuula Kallunki. Their work appears in journals such as Journal of Biological Chemistry, The EMBO Journal, Proceedings of the National Academy of Sciences, The Journal of Immunology and Molecular and Cellular Biology.
